php - Amazon SNS 使用 PHP 推送主题

标签 php amazon-web-services amazon-sns

我正在尝试了解适用于 AWS 的 amazon php sdk,但我真的无法使用它。 我找到了一些基本类来创建、显示和推送主题,但我也没有用。 我只是想找到一种方法(最简单的方法)从我的网站上推送一个主题。

最佳答案

首先,要熟悉 Amazon Simple Notification Service (SNS) ,我建议通过 AWS Management Console 手动执行所有必需的步骤一次如 Getting Started Guide 中所述,即 Create a Topic , Subscribe to this TopicPublish a message to it .

之后,应该相当直接地促进 AWS SDK for PHP 文档中提供的示例片段。运行,参见例如方法 publish()在类 AmazonSNS 中:

$sns = new AmazonSNS();

// Get topic attributes
$response = $sns->publish(
    'arn:aws:sns:us-east-1:9876543210:example-topic',
    'This is my very first message to the world!',
    array(
        'Subject' => 'Hello world!'
    )
);

// Success?
var_dump($response->isOK());

有关更完整的示例,您可能需要查看 Sending Messages Using SNS [...] 中提供的示例.

如果这些都没有解决,您将必须按照 tster 的要求提供有关您遇到的具体问题的更多详细信息。已经。

祝你好运!

关于php - Amazon SNS 使用 PHP 推送主题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9697234/

相关文章:

javascript - Prestashop - 如何添加内联脚本?

javascript - 使用 AWS Javascript 开发工具包发送 SMS

amazon-web-services - DynamoDB - 每个帐户的表数量限制

amazon-web-services - 使用 CLI 将逗号分隔的参数传递给 AWS EMR 中的 spark jar

amazon-web-services - 您可以从 Amazon AWS 中的 lambda 函数发送 SNS 推送通知吗?

node.js - 使用 AWS SNS 的浏览器通知

PHP:根据上一页点击的链接动态加载内容?

php - Magento 在后端的销售发货网格中添加一列

php - 将文章存储在数据库中的最佳方式? (PHP 和 SQL)

amazon-web-services - 如何在ec2上的tomcat上添加aws ssl证书